If George Washington had not rescued the dog, it .....................

Awould have suffered much.

Bwill have suffered much.

Cwould have jumped out of the pit.

Dwouldn't have suffered much.

Answer:

A. would have suffered much.

Read Explanation:

"If George Washington had not rescued the dog, it would have suffered much."

This is an example of a third conditional sentence, which is used to express a hypothetical situation in the past and its possible outcome. In this case, the dog would have suffered if Washington had not intervened.
